NovaBit Trading Center: What is decentralization?

Decentralization in blockchain refers to the transfer of control and decision-making from a centralized entity (individual, organization, or group) to a distributed network. Decentralized networks strive to reduce the level of trust participants must place in each other and prevent them from exerting authority or control in ways that could undermine the network's functionality.
Why decentralization matters
Decentralization is not a new concept. When designing technological solutions, three primary network architectures are typically considered: centralized, distributed, and decentralized. Although blockchain technology often employs decentralized networks, blockchain applications themselves cannot simply be categorized as decentralized or not. Instead, decentralization is a sliding scale that should be applied to various aspects of blockchain applications. By decentralizing the management and access to resources within an application, better and fairer services can be achieved. Decentralization often requires trade-offs, such as reduced transaction throughput, but ideally, these trade-offs are worthwhile because they can enhance stability and service levels.
Benefits of decentralization
Creating a trustless environment
In a decentralized blockchain network, no one needs to know or trust anyone else. Every member of the network has an identical copy of the data in the form of a distributed ledger. If a member's ledger is altered or corrupted in any way, it will be rejected by the majority of the network members.
Improved data coordination
Companies frequently exchange data with their partners. In turn, this data is often transformed and stored in each party's data silos, only to reappear when needed downstream. Each data transformation introduces the risk of data loss or erroneous data entering the workflow. With decentralized data storage, each entity can access a real-time, shared view of the data.
Reducing weak points
Decentralization can reduce the weak points in a system that may rely too heavily on specific actors. These weak points can lead to systemic failures, including the inability to provide promised services or inefficiencies due to resource exhaustion, periodic outages, bottlenecks, insufficient incentives for good service, or corruption.
Optimizing resource allocation: Decentralization also helps optimize resource allocation, resulting in better performance and consistency of promised services and reducing the likelihood of catastrophic failures.
